Output 7c3664159a9d64eb2b395939c58e1a506ea368756d41fc1e4ec3129e2335e635:1

value
1139615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d0e3c337e41b284c16f919da929be25415174a6 OP_EQUALVERIFY OP_CHECKSIG
address
1CQEX4CPUAmQWKgDJvNusbigsraEXH3VMd
transaction
7c3664159a9d64eb2b395939c58e1a506ea368756d41fc1e4ec3129e2335e635
spent
true